资源帖-优秀博客、iOS开发技术文、学习网站

资源帖-优秀博客、iOS开发技术文、学习网站_第1张图片

图片发自简书App

一些博客

  • 王巍 Objc中国发起人、Line工程师
  • ibireme YYKit作者
  • bang JSPatch作者
  • 唐巧 《iOS开发进阶》作者、猿题库工程师
  • 孙源 前百度工程师,现滴滴工程师
  • 玉令天下
  • xuyafei
  • 张不坏
  • NSHipster中文版
  • glow
  • 刚刚在线
  • 里脊串
  • Jamin
  • 阿毛的蛋疼地
  • zeeyang
  • Tian Wei Yu
  • Kitten
  • MR.Riddler

简书优秀文章

iOS 技术文

  • 网络
    • iOS 升级HTTPS通过ATS你所要知道的
    • iOS网络缓存扫盲篇--使用两行代码就能完成80%的缓存需求
    • iOS开发之AFNetworking 3.0.4使用
    • iOS开发 AFNetworking 3.0使用遇到的问题补充
    • 正确使用AFNetworking的SSL保证网络安全
    • iOS开发中WiFi相关功能总结
    • iOS应用支持IPV6,就那点事儿
    • 基于iOS 10、realm封装的下载器(支持存储读取、断点续传、后台下载、杀死APP重启后的断点续传等功能)
    • 网络层的搭建需要解决哪些问题
    • YTKNetwork集成教程以及相关问题思考
    • 关于iOS工程中网络请求管理的头脑风暴
    • 计算机网络中的TCP/UDP协议到底是怎么回事(一)
    • 计算机网络中的TCP/UDP协议到底是怎么回事(二)
  • block
    • iOS中__block 关键字的底层实现原理
    • 深入研究Block捕获外部变量和__block实现原理
    • iOS OC语言: Block底层实现原理
    • Block技巧与底层解析
    • 深入浅出-iOS Block原理和内存中位置
  • 多线程
  • 谈谈iOS面试常提及到的线程间的通信
  • 关于iOS多线程,你看我就够了
  • GCD与多线程编程
  • 存储
    • Realm数据库 从入门到“放弃”
    • iOS/NSUserDefaults详解
    • iOS基于ORM思想的数据库处理
    • iOS数据库离线缓存思路和网络层封装
    • iOS架构师之路:本地持久化方案
  • 推送
    • 国内 90%以上的 iOS 开发者,对 APNs 的认识都是错的
    • iOS 10 消息推送(UserNotifications)秘籍总结(一)
    • iOS推送之远程推送(iOS Notification Of Remote Notification)
    • iOS推送之本地推送(iOS Notification Of Local Notification)
  • 支付
    • 真·iOS内购的完整流程
    • iOS开发 内购流程 手把手教你还不学?
    • iOS开发内购全套图文教程
    • 【iOS】苹果内购调研
  • 多媒体
    • iOS中集成ijkplayer视频直播框架
    • iOS视频边下边播--缓存播放数据流
    • iOS仿微信小视频功能开发优化记录
    • 浅谈iOS视频播放的N种解决方案
    • IOS 微信聊天发送小视频的秘密(AVAssetReader+AVAssetReaderTrackOutput播放视频)
    • iOS仿微博视频边下边播之封装播放器
    • 微信语音连播的实现思路
    • iOS播放远程网络音乐的核心技术点
    • 【如何快速的开发一个完整的iOS直播app】(原理篇)
    • 【如何快速的开发一个完整的iOS直播app】(播放篇)
    • 【如何快速的开发一个完整的iOS直播app】(采集篇)
    • 【如何快速的开发一个完整的iOS直播app】(美颜篇)
    • 快速集成iOS基于RTMP的视频推流
  • 图片
    • 在 iOS 开发中如何优雅地进行图片缩放?
  • 系统适配
    • iOS 10 的适配问题
    • 兼容iOS 10 资料整理笔记
  • Runloop
    • 深入研究 Runloop 与线程保活
    • RunLoop基础元素解析
    • iOS 开发 - 深入理解 NSTimer 为什么要配合 NSRunLoop 进行使用
  • Runtime
    • 轻松学习之二——iOS利用Runtime自定义控制器POP手势动画
    • 【OC刨根问底】-Runtime简单粗暴理解
    • iOS中利用 runtime 一键改变字体
    • 谈Runtime机制和使用的整体化梳理
    • Objective-C特性:Runtime
    • iOS 万能跳转界面方法 (runtime实用篇一)
    • 让你快速上手Runtime
    • iOS开发之runtime精准获取电池电量
    • iOS~runtime理解
    • 神经病院Objective-C Runtime出院第三天——如何正确使用Runtime
    • Runtime 10种用法(没有比这更全的了)
  • 动画
    • iOS开发基础知识:Core Animation(核心动画)
  • CoreGraphics
    • Quartz2D 编程指南(一)概览、图形上下文、路径、颜色与颜色空间
    • Quartz2D 编程指南(二)变换、图案、阴影
    • Quartz2D 编程指南(三)渐变、透明层 、数据管理
    • Quartz2D 编程指南(四)位图与图像遮罩、CoreGraphics 绘制 Layer
    • UIBezierPath精讲
    • iOS开发之——从零开始完成页面切换形变动画
  • 消息机制
    • 轻松学习之一--Objective-C消息转发
    • 史上最详细的iOS之事件的传递和响应机制-原理篇
    • iOS开发-事件传递响应链
    • 响应者链及相关机制总结
  • 加密解密
    • iOS,一行代码进行RSA、DES 、AES加密、解密及MD5加密
  • 架构
    • iOS开发-去model化开发
    • iOS开发-MVC架构杂谈
    • iOS开发-均衡代码职责
    • iOS组件化思路-大神博客研读和思考
  • Github
    • 最新版MJRefresh解析与详细使用指导
    • MJExtension使用指导(转)
    • 如何使用Carthage管理iOS依赖库
    • Github上的iOS App源码 (中文)
    • iOS学习资源汇总(开源项目、第三方库、技术博客等等)
    • iOS 高仿Timi记账
    • iOS 项目源码大全 github 国内外大神
  • View
    • iOS 实现时间线列表效果
    • iOS雷达图 iOS RadarChart实现
    • iOS 高效添加圆角效果实战讲解
    • iOS tableviewCell的多行选择删除和全选删除
    • 【阿峥教你实现UITableView循环利用】 |那些人追的干货
    • UICollectionView 全解
    • iOS一分钟学会环形进度条
    • 【文字渐变效果】 |那些人追的干货
    • iOS 关于navigationBar的一些:毛玻璃、透明、动态缩放、动态隐藏
  • 富文本
    • CoreText实现图文混排
  • 性能调优
    • iOS 性能调优,成为一名合格iOS程序员必须掌握的技能
    • Instruments性能检测
    • 移动端监控体系之技术原理剖析
  • 上线App Store
    • 从2月14号开始,上传AppStore会碰到:Failed to locate or generate matching signing assets
  • 开发中遇到的那点儿事
    • iOS开发之如何跳到系统设置里的各种设置界面
    • 事无巨细系列之iOS开发者证书、推送证书、真机调试详解
    • iOS-两种时间格式实现几天前,几小时前,几分钟前
    • iOS中的谓词(NSPredicate)使用
    • 深入理解iOS开发中的BitCode功能
    • iOS开发-超链接富文本
    • iOS开发-SiriKit应用
    • iOS使用UICountingLabel实现数字变化的动画效果
    • 谈谈 Objective-C 链式语法的实现
    • iOS 10 创建iMessage App
    • iOS9新特性之实现3D Touch就是So easy(更新Swift版)
    • iOS 开发中你不能不知道的一个 class
    • iOS 项目的目录结构能看出你的开发经验
    • iOS 开发中你是否遇到这些经验问题(一)
    • iOS 开发中你是否遇到这些经验问题(二)
    • iOS 证书详解
    • iOS 宏(define)与常量(const)的正确使用
  • 源码解读
    • 叶孤城带你读源码之RESideMenu
    • SDWebImage源码解析之SDWebImageManager的注解
    • SDWebImage源码解析之SDWebImageManager的注解(2)
    • 一行行看SDWebImage源码(一)
    • 一行行看SDWebImage源码(二)
    • JSONModel源码解析一
    • JSONModel源码解析二
    • iOS AFNetWorking源码详解(一)
    • iOS AFNetWorking源码详解(二)
    • iOS AFNetWorking源码详解(三)
    • iOS AFNetWorking源码详解(四)
    • iOS AFNetWorking源码详解(五)
    • iOS AFNetWorking源码详解(六)
  • 技术面试
    • 《招聘一个靠谱的 iOS》—参考答案(一)
    • 《招聘一个靠谱的 iOS》—参考答案(二)
    • 《招聘一个靠谱的 iOS》—参考答案(三)
    • 答卓同学的iOS面试题
    • iOS面试题大全-点亮你iOS技能树
    • 你能用到的iOS面试题(一)
    • 你能用到的iOS面试题(二)
    • 【如何正确使用const,static,extern】|那些人追的干货
    • iOS基础问答面试题连载(一)-附答案
  • 爱钻研的大神都研究些啥
    • 趣探 Mach-O:文件格式分析
    • 趣探 Mach-O:加载过程
    • 趣探 Mach-O:FishHook 解析
    • 了解iOS上的可执行文件和Mach-O格式
    • 点击 Run 之后发生了什么?

面试

  • 猎头教你写简历
  • 面试你之前,我希望在简历上看到这些!
  • 想涨工资?你得先学会怎么写简历(真实案例分析)
  • iOS萌新救助站一:简历要写几个项目

学习网站

  • Linux C一站式学习
  • 鸟哥的私房菜
  • 廖雪峰官网
  • SwiftGG
  • objc中国



作者:悟空没空
链接:https://www.jianshu.com/p/619c61d9c8fb
來源:简书
简书著作权归作者所有,任何形式的转载都请联系作者获得授权并注明出处。

你可能感兴趣的:(iOS开发)